Etymology of the Latin word scientia
the Latin word
scientia (knowledge, science; skill)
derived from the Latin word
sciens (conscious of; aware, cognizant)
derived from the Late Latin word
scire (know, understand)
derived from the Proto-Indo-European root
*skei-Derivations in Latin
